hi am new on code vein and I got one question about Io
code vein how to repair all Eos vestige do I talk to Io or one of attendant of the relics?? because am very confused

As you advance you find different character's vestiges which you then take to Io to repair / view.

As for Io's hers are the same but they can be taken to Io or the Io clones just before critical bosses. If a boss has an Io clone before it that means they have two fates. You fail to restore vestiges causes their bad fate (death) and a specific code associated with that while if you find all their vestiges and restore it before the boss fight you then get the option to save them (or still let them die if you choose) which grants a different code. Neither code is inherently better FYI. This only influences the ending as there are four endings.

As you progress you will find more of Io's own vestiges to restore her memories with her final one being near the end of the game. NOTE: Do NOT pick up the final Io memory if you are trying to get the two best endings in one playthrough. Finish the game with saving all the bosses that can be saved and the second best ending (missing at least one of Io's memories). Then run up and pick up Io's final memory and view it with Io restoring that vestige. Beat final boss again. If you don't care about achievements then you can just pick it up as the ending almost identical except Io says one extra word (its one of the worst enhanced endings I've ever seen and should have just been a single ending...).

Also worth noting is Io's vestiges are linked to her AI's skills unlike all other AI partners that start with all skills unlocked. Io gets stronger the more of her memories you restore, granted she will still be second best after Yakumo (but Io and Yakumo are both way ahead of the rest of the partners).

The first half of the vestiges are on the ground where each successors attendants were standing, outside the arenas, the second half are in government areas.

I give them to Io because she will have extra scenes after you view the memory and talk about them, the clone attendants will only show the memory. But yeah either work the same minus the extra dialogue.
